Skiing, snowshoeing, hiking, and biking and other forms of similar recreation are not allowed, and access is not accessible, beyond Lake McDonald Lodge while crews are working. Current estimates approximate that the earliest date at which the upper region of Going-to-the-Sun Road could open is June 22. Steady progress has been underway ever since. Spring plowing on the scenic mountain roadway is an annual - and typically arduous - process. Segments open to vehicle and foot traffic consist of Camas Road, Chief Mountain Road, Many Glacier Road, and Two Medicine Road, to name a few. Other prohibited roads include Inside North Fork Road (at Logging Creek RS and Fishing Creek) and Cut Bank Road (at Ranger Station). The area between Jackson Glacier Overlook and Avalanche is closed presently. Mary Entrance to Jackson Glacier Overlook,” the park’s website said. The route’s plowed sections allow for visitors to drive “15.5 miles from the park’s West Entrance to Avalanche” and “13.5 miles from the St. The west side of the park has been plowed up to Rimrocks, and east side plow crews have progressed all the way to Siyeh Bend.
